#8B193F Hex Color Code

#8B193F

The Hexadecimal Color #8B193F is a contrast shade of Brown. #8B193F RGB value is rgb(139, 25, 63). RGB Color Model of #8B193F consists of 54% red, 9% green and 24% blue. HSL color Mode of #8B193F has 340°(degrees) Hue, 70% Saturation and 32% Lightness. #8B193F color has an wavelength of 405.92593n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#8B193F is #993366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#8B193F is #814. The Closest Color to #8B193F is #A52A2A. Official Name of #8B193F Hex Code is Merlot.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#8B193F is 0 Cyan 82 Magenta 55 Yellow 45 Black and #8B193F CMY is 0, 82, 55.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#8B193F is hsl(340,70,32,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(340, 82, 55).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#8B193F is 11.89, 6.54, 5.34.
Hex8 Value of #8B193F is #8B193FFF. Decimal Value of #8B193F is 9115967 and Octal Value of #8B193F is 42614477. Binary Value of #8B193F is 10001011, 11001, 111111 and Android of #8B193F is 4287306047 / 0xff8b193f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#8B193F is 0.5, 0.275, 0.275 and YIQ Color Space of #8B193F is 63.418, 55.7232, 35.9366.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#8B193F is 10.66, 2.77, 5.38.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#8B193F is 30.74, 48.62, 7.37.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#8B193F is 30.74, 71.76, -0.5.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#8B193F is 30.74, 49.18, 8.62. Hunter Lab variable of #8B193F is 25.57, 38.24, 5.52.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#8B193F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
